This episode gets practical. From simple, no-cost changes—like rewriting job descriptions to attract more diverse candidates—to building psychological safety and creating policies that actually support women in the workplace, Jade and Hannah share what works, what doesn’t, and where organizations still fall short.
They also explore the power of community: the role of peer networks, trusted sounding boards, and “finding your people” in building confidence, navigating career decisions, and unlocking leadership potential.
Plus, a candid look at what real commitment looks like inside organizations—from equitable pay and promotions to who gets second chances—and why intent only matters when it shows up in decisions.
And in a lightning round, Jade and Hannah share:
- The best advice they’ve ever received
- The most underrated leadership skills in parking
- What the public still misunderstands about the industry
- And the moments that made them most proud
This isn’t just a conversation about supporting women—it’s about eliminating wasted talent, perspective, and leadership across the entire industry.
If Part 1 asked why this matters, Part 2 focuses on what to do next.
